Healthy Protein-Packed Bento Box Recipe with Easy Turkey Roll-Ups for Meal Prep

healthy protein-packed bento box - featured image

A quick and easy bento box featuring smoked turkey roll-ups with avocado and fresh veggies, perfect for meal prep and balanced nutrition.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 68 slices thinly sliced smoked turkey breast
  • 1 ripe avocado, sliced or mashed
  • 1/2 cucumber, sliced into thin strips
  • 1 cup baby spinach or mixed greens
  • 1/2 red bell pepper, thinly sliced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h herbs (dill or parsley), finely chopped (optional)
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1/4 cup almonds or mixed nuts
  • 1/2 cup baby carrots or snap peas
  • Whole grain crackers or rice cakes (optional)
  • Hummus or Greek yogurt dip
  • 1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ice
  • Salt and freshly cracked black pepper to taste
  • Olive oil (optional, for drizzling)
  • Everything bagel seasoning (optional)

Instructions

  1. Wash and dry all fresh produce. Slice cucumber and red bell pepper into thin strips. Halve the cherry tomatoes. Trim baby carrots or snap peas if needed.
  2. In a small bowl, mash the ripe avocado with a squeeze of fresh lemon juice,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Set aside.
  3. Lay a slice of smoked turkey flat on a cutting board. Spread a thin layer of avocado mash evenly across the slice. Place a few strips of cucumber and red bell pepper in the center, add a small handful of baby spinach or mixed greens, and sprinkle chopped fresh herbs if using. Roll the turkey slice tightly around the filling to create a neat cylinder. Repeat with remaining slices.
  4. Arrange the turkey roll-ups in one compartment of the bento box. Fill other sections with cherry tomatoes, baby carrots or snap peas, almonds or mixed nuts, and whole grain crackers or rice cakes if using. Include a small container of hummus or Greek yogurt dip for dipping.
  5. Drizzle a touch of olive oil and sprinkle everything bagel seasoning on the roll-ups if desired. Close the bento box tightly and store in the fridge if not eating immediately.

Notes

Use thinly sliced smoked turkey breast for pliability. Add lemon juice to avocado to prevent browning. Don’t overfill roll-ups to keep them intact. Store in fridge up to 3 days. Include dips separately to avoid sogginess. Roll-ups are best eaten chilled or at room temperature.
